On Saturday, Sept. 16, the Arts Council of Moore County and the Pinehurst Parks and Recreation Dept. will present the second of three "Arts in the Park" events at Camelot Playground in Cannon Park, Pinehurst.
This performance will feature the magic and comedy of Fish the Magish at 11 a.m.
The performance is free and open to the public.
In case of rain, the performance will be in Assembly Hall of the Village Hall (395 Magnolia Road, Pinehurst).
Attendees are encouraged to bring chairs or blankets to sit on during the performance.
Specializing in children's magic, Fish the Magish returns to "Arts in the Park" with his refreshing mix of magic, comedy, audience participation, balloons and a few surprises.
In addition to Fish's performance, free face painting will be provided from 10 to 10:45 a.m., and refreshments will be for sale.
The final "Arts in the Park" will feature the Grey Seal Puppets performing "Tangle of Tales" on Saturday, Sept. 23.
